(1) (a) On
or before July 1, 2024, the department and the department of health care policy and
financing shall jointly create, develop, or contract, which may include the cost of
renovation at private facilities, for at least an additional one hundred and twenty-five beds at mental health residential facilities throughout the state based on the
greatest areas of need. The beds in the mental health facilities are available for
adult individuals in need of ongoing supportive services, but individuals with a
severe mental illness or a dual diagnosis of mental illness and alcohol or substance
use disorder must be prioritized. When available, the department shall use existing
department properties for the mental health facilities.
(b) At a minimum, the department shall ensure that the mental health
residential facilities offer the following services:
(I) Assistance with medication;
(II) Direct support personnel including assistance with activities of daily
living;
(III) Intensive case management services;
(IV) Life skills training; and
(V) Non-medical transportation.
(c) The department and the department of health care policy and financing
shall work collaboratively to ensure the beds in the mental health facilities are
eligible for federal funding through the medical assistance program.
(2) (a) The beds at the mental health facilities created pursuant to this
section are intended primarily for adult individuals with serious mental illness or a
co-occurring mental health and substance use disorder in need of services. A
mental health facility may also provide services to an individual in need of
competency restoration pursuant to article 8.5 of title 16 who does not require
imprisonment in a jail.
(b) The department, in collaboration with the behavioral health
administration and the department of health care policy and financing, shall
prioritize placement for individuals in the civil system who are leaving the mental
health institutes at Pueblo and Fort Logan, civil individuals being discharged from
inpatient settings, individuals receiving involuntary mental health treatment
pursuant to article 65 of this title 27, and civil individuals in need of residential
services who are in a mental health crisis facility, acute care hospital, or in the
community.
(c) The state department, in collaboration with the behavioral health
administration and the department of health care policy and financing, shall
establish criteria for admissions and discharge planning, quality assurance
monitoring, appropriate length of stay, and compliance with applicable federal law.
For the mental health residential facilities created pursuant to this section,
admission criteria for facilities must include:
(I) Prioritization of people with serious mental illness who have complex or
co-occurring conditions as defined by the state department; and
(II) For treatment beds that do not serve individuals covered under a home-
and community-based waiver, offering priority placement to individuals under a
certification for short-term or extended short-term treatment pursuant to section
27-65-107 or 27-65-108 and long-term care and treatment pursuant to section 27-65-109 on an outpatient basis.
(d) The state department shall collaborate with relevant stakeholders when
establishing the criteria described in subsection (2)(c) of this section.
(3) The department shall distribute the money for the creation of additional
beds pursuant to this section no later than December 30, 2024. Any person
receiving money pursuant to this section shall spend or obligate all money received
in accordance with section 24-75-226 (4)(d).
